I want to test for this input:
[an optional negative sign] 2 digits [an optional . and an optional digit] like this:



-34 or -34.5333 or 34.53333 or 34 in JavaScript



This is what I came up with but it doesn't work!



/^(-)d{2}(.d{1})$/


Can someone please help me?

Try this regex:



/^-?d{2}(.d+)?$/
